A whistleblower who blew the whistle on government contract fraud will receive $4.5 million as part of a settlement between the government and MPC Products Corp., a manufacturer and supplier of fighter jets, helicopters and other military systems.  The whistleblower, Joe Caputo, reported that he was ordered to falsify cost and price justifications so MPC could increase its profit margins on government contracts.  MPC will pay some $25 million as part of the settlement.
